The Attic Environment

What the Attic Environment Does to Duct Systems in Baxter Springs, KS

Summer Attic Temperatures and Flexible Duct in Baxter Springs

An unventilated or poorly ventilated attic in summer reaches temperatures of 130 to 150 degrees Fahrenheit in most climates in Baxter Springs, KS. Flexible duct in this environment is simultaneously carrying 55-degree conditioned air and surrounded by 130-degree attic air in Baxter Springs. The outer jacket of flexible duct is designed to withstand elevated temperatures, but sustained exposure to these temperature extremes degrades the materials progressively in Baxter Springs, KS. The foil outer jacket becomes brittle. The insulation batting compresses and loses its R-value in Baxter Springs. And the inner liner becomes less flexible and more prone to cracking at bend points in Baxter Springs, KS. A flexible duct installed correctly 15 years ago may be significantly deteriorated by the accumulated effect of 15 summer seasons in a 130-degree attic in Baxter Springs.

The Thermal Cycling That Progressively Loosens Connections in Baxter Springs, KS

Every HVAC cycle creates a temperature transition at every duct connection in the attic in Baxter Springs. When the system starts in cooling mode, cold conditioned air enters the attic duct sections and chills the connections in Baxter Springs, KS. When the system shuts off, the connection rapidly warms back to attic temperature in Baxter Springs. In summer, an HVAC system may cycle this way dozens of times per day in Baxter Springs, KS. Each cycle applies a small mechanical stress to every connection as the materials expand and contract in Baxter Springs. Over hundreds of cycles per season and thousands over a few years, these small stresses progressively work the connections loose in Baxter Springs, KS.

Pest Access and Physical Disturbance in Baxter Springs

Attic spaces are accessible to squirrels, rats, and mice that find the warm, insulated duct system an attractive nesting and gnawing target in Baxter Springs, KS. Rodents gnaw through flexible duct outer jackets and inner liners to access the interior in Baxter Springs. Every visit to the attic for electrical work, insulation installation, or roofing repair creates opportunities for duct damage from physical disturbance in Baxter Springs, KS. A worker stepping on a flexible duct crushes it at that point. Many attic duct faults are discovered years after the work that caused them in Baxter Springs.

Common Attic Duct Problems

Common Attic Duct Problems Air America Repairs in Baxter Springs, KS

Disconnected Attic Duct Sections in Baxter Springs

The most common and most impactful attic duct fault is disconnected duct sections where connections have separated in Baxter Springs, KS. A disconnected supply duct in the attic delivers 55-degree conditioned air into a 130-degree attic space rather than to the room it was supposed to serve in Baxter Springs. The conditioned air instantly mixes with the hot attic air and has zero cooling effect on the living spaces in Baxter Springs, KS. Air America reconnects disconnected attic duct sections using mechanical connections and mastic sealant rated for attic temperature conditions in Baxter Springs.

Torn or Collapsed Flexible Duct in the Attic in Baxter Springs, KS

Flexible duct in the attic develops tears and collapses from the combination of material deterioration, physical disturbance, and pest activity in Baxter Springs. A tear in the flexible duct liner allows conditioned air to escape and allows hot attic air to enter the duct in Baxter Springs, KS. A collapsed section from kinking or crushing creates a partial or complete blockage that restricts or prevents airflow to the register in Baxter Springs.

Deteriorated Attic Duct Insulation in Baxter Springs

The insulation on attic flexible duct deteriorates from sustained high-temperature exposure, UV degradation, pest activity, and physical disturbance in Baxter Springs, KS. A supply duct carrying 55-degree air through an attic with deteriorated or missing insulation may deliver air that is 75 or 80 degrees to the register in Baxter Springs. The system effectively loses a significant portion of its cooling capacity before the conditioned air reaches the room in Baxter Springs, KS.

Sagging Flexible Duct From Inadequate Support in Baxter Springs, KS

Flexible duct that sags significantly between supports develops low points that accumulate condensate in Baxter Springs. The pooled condensate restricts airflow through the duct and over time can damage the duct liner from the inside in Baxter Springs, KS. Severely sagging duct also develops kinking at support points that creates flow restrictions in Baxter Springs.

Pest-Damaged Attic Ductwork in Baxter Springs, KS

Rodent damage includes gnaw holes through the outer jacket and inner liner, nesting material packed into duct sections, and droppings on and around duct surfaces in Baxter Springs. Air America replaces pest-damaged attic duct sections and provides written documentation for pest control coordination and insurance purposes in Baxter Springs, KS.

Crushed Duct at Attic Access Points in Baxter Springs

The flexible duct nearest to the attic access hatch is the most frequently physically disturbed section because every attic visit passes over or near the access area in Baxter Springs, KS. Ducts near the access hatch are commonly found crushed, kinked, or compressed from being stepped on during attic access in Baxter Springs.

Attic flexible duct should be insulated to at least R-6 and ideally R-8 in most climates in Baxter Springs. Higher R-values reduce the heat gain the conditioned air experiences as it passes through the hot attic in Baxter Springs, KS. Air America assesses the insulation R-value adequacy for the local climate during every attic duct repair visit in Baxter Springs.
Attic flexible ducts sag when not adequately supported at the intervals specified for the specific duct diameter in Baxter Springs. Inadequate support allows the duct to sag between support points, creating low spots that accumulate condensate in Baxter Springs, KS. Severe sagging creates kinks at support points that restrict airflow in Baxter Springs.
